    19, NEWBY CRESCENT, HARROGATE, HG3 2TS

    This flat/maisonette leasehold property on Newby Crescent last sold in October 2017 for £109,950. Based on price growth in the HG3 district since then, its estimated current value is £117,020 — placing it in the 6th percentile nationally and the 2nd percentile within HG3. The property covers 41 m² (441 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£2,854 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of C.

    District Context — HG3

    HG3 covers rural areas in North Yorkshire, situated in the Pennine region between Harrogate and the dales. It is a quieter, countryside location with a distinctly older demographic and a strong owner-occupier market.
